Coach Brian Flores has already decided that Tua Tagovailoa is the starter. Is this decision made for this week or for the future as well? I’d say in some ways it’s probably both, but I also believe that Flores believes Tua is his best QB. I don’t think Flores is a puppet and no one is pulling his strings. He’s making the personnel decisions and he’s declared Tua is the QB. Once again, I mean absolutely no disrespect to QB Ryan Fitzpatrick but there is a fine line between Fitzmagic and Fitztragic. He’s a gambler, and as everyone knows, sometimes ya win and sometimes ya lose. I’m going to enlighten some of you here, so be prepared. Over Ryan Fitzpatrick’s career, his TD% is 4.4 and his INT% is 3.3. Tua Tagovailoa in his short career has a TD% of 4.3 and an INT% of 0.9%. This doesn’t tell the entire story, and there are many metrics to look at, but I think Flores wants a player that’s careful with the football, and Tua Tagovailoa is that guy. That doesn’t mean he couldn’t be better, he can, and hopefully Sunday he will be.

The Bills are 12-3 for a reason. The best teams in the NFL score points, and the Bills are the 4th best scoring offense at 29.7 PPG. Their passing offense is #2 in the NFL throwing for 4,398 yards. Josh Allen is having a monster year, completing 69.1 % of his passes with 4,320 yards with 34 TD’s and just 9 INT’s. The Bills defense is stingier giving up yards than our Dolphins as they are ranked at the #10 defense in the NFL but they are allowing nearly a TD more per game than our defense. Their rushing attack is on par with our own rushing attack and they have used a 1-2 punch with Devin Singletary and Zack Moss. They are 19th in the league rushing and we are 22nd. The problem is their rushing attack doesn’t stop with these 2. QB Josh Allen is a legitimate weapon with over 4oo yards rushing and 8 rushing TD’s. When they’re in the red zone, you have to account for the QB running as well.

On the injury front, we know that LB Elandon Roberts is OUT along with Jakeem Grant. Practicing on a limited basis were WR DeVante Parker, OL Solomon Kindley and S Bobby McCain. McCain is not a threat to miss the game. Both TE Mike Gesicki and G Ereck Flowers were both FULL participants. That’s good news. I think Elandon Roberts is done for the season and that’s unfortunate. He wouldn’t be getting as many snaps this week anyway because the Bills throw the ball more. Can we talk about a Dolphins defender who gets very little ink in NFL circles? #55, Jerome Baker is having a great season. He leads the Dolphins with 108 tackles, he has 11 QB hits, 7 tackles for a loss along with 7 sacks and 2 forced fumbles. This really is a no-name defense, with the exception of X who is known league wide. So many contributors including lesser known Zach Sieler, Elandon Roberts, Eric Rowe, Andrew Van Ginkel, rookie Raekwon Davis, Christian Wilkins, Nik Needham and a guy who leads the Dolphins in sacks, Emmanuel Ogbah. Hope Ogbah can be the first Dolphins defender since Cam Wake to have double digit sacks with a great game against the Bills. We need to take Josh Allen down!
